Automation risk

18% (Minimal Risk)

Minimal Risk (0-20%): Occupations in this category have a low probability of being automated, as they typically demand complex problem-solving, creativity, strong interpersonal skills, and a high degree of manual dexterity. These jobs often involve intricate hand movements and precise coordination, making it difficult for machines to replicate the required tasks.

More information on what this score is, and how it is calculated is available here.

Some quite important qualities of the job are difficult to automate:

  • Originality

  • Negotiation

  • Persuasion

  • Social Perceptiveness

Wages

Very high paid relative to other professions

In 2023, the median annual wage for 'Social Scientists and Related Workers, All Other' was $95,890, or $46 per hour

'Social Scientists and Related Workers, All Other' were paid 99.5% higher than the national median wage, which stood at $48,060

Volume

Lower range of job opportunities compared to other professions

As of 2023 there were 35,210 people employed as 'Social Scientists and Related Workers, All Other' within the United States.

This represents around < 0.001% of the employed workforce across the country

Put another way, around 1 in 4 thousand people are employed as 'Social Scientists and Related Workers, All Other'.

Job description

Prepare studies for proposed transportation projects. Gather, compile, and analyze data. Study the use and operation of transportation systems. Develop transportation models or simulations.

SOC Code: 19-3099.01
